UNI pitcher honored after tossing a no hitter

April 1, 2008 By admin

The honors keep pouring in for UNI junior pitcher Nick Kirk who tossed a no-hitter last Friday in the Panther’s 3-0 win over Evansville. It was the Panther’s first nine inning no-hitter since the program moved to division one.

Kirk has been named the Missouri Valley Conference player of the week and also was named Louisville Slugger’s national player of the week. UNI assistant coach Marty Sutherland who says the numbers show just how dominant Kirk was. The Panthers are scheduled to host Grand View in a non conference game on Wednesday afternoon.
